DGHSIMR-I – Hostel Accommodation and Fees
Room Type | Occupancy | Hostel Fees (Per Academic Year) | Payment Terms |
Accommodation only | Two Seater / Three Seater | INR 60,000 (Sharing basis) | Fees can be paid in two installments |
DGHSIMR-II – Mess Charges
The mess charges at GHS IMR are calculated on actual consumption and shared among residents, ensuring students pay according to their usage and participation in the meal plan.
